ingredients
- 1 medium baking potato
- cooking spray
- 1⁄4 cup low-fat cheddar cheese or 1/4 cup colby cheese
- 2 tablespoons bacon bits
- 2 -3 tablespoons fat free sour cream
directions
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
- Scrub potato and rinse.
- Cut potato into 1/2" strips, leaving skin on.
- Spray baking sheet with cooking spray.
- Place potato strips on baking sheet, skin side down.
- Bake for 20 minutes, then turn potatoes and bake additonal 15 minutes.
- Top fries with cheese and sprinkle with bacon bits.
- Return baking sheet to oven for a minute to melt the cheese.
- Add optional dollop of sour cream to top or on the side.
